    PalmPay and AXA Mansard partner to offer affordable health insurance in Nigeria

    PalmPay, a leading fintech platform, has teamed up with AXA Mansard Health, Nigeria’s largest health insurance company, to provide accessible and affordable digital health insurance to millions of Nigerians. This collaboration allows PalmPay users to easily access a variety of health insurance packages from AXA Mansard directly through the PalmPay app.

    Starting at just N500 per month, the insurance plans are designed to meet diverse needs. For example, the AXA Digital Health plan provides telemedicine consultations with doctors, N5,000 worth of medications, and up to N40,000 in surgical coverage.

    For a monthly fee of N1,000, users can opt for the AXA Mansard MicroHealth plan, which includes unlimited diagnostic tests and funeral benefits. The AXA Mansard Accident plan is also available for N500 per month and offers comprehensive death coverage for both accidental and non-accidental cases.

    According to Habib Kowontan, PalmPay’s Head of Wealth Product, this partnership is a significant step toward making insurance more accessible. He stated that it “breaks down long-standing barriers by placing reliable and affordable insurance solutions right at our users’ fingertips.”

    Jumoke Odunlami, Chief Distribution Officer at AXA Mansard Insurance, highlighted that the partnership is part of a broader mission to improve the health and productivity of Nigerians. “Through partnerships like this, we are covering over 1.8 million Nigerians and ensuring that healthcare is accessible, available and affordable,” she said.

    This partnership aligns with PalmPay’s mission to build a more inclusive digital financial ecosystem, empowering users to not only manage their finances but also secure their future.
